Refrigeration Engineer Basic £42,000pa Monday – Friday / Door to door pay / 33 days holiday / NO ON CALL We are a South Coast based Commercial Catering & Refrigeration company, priding ourselves on our expert knowledge, maintenance, service and repairs for the catering, hospitality and public sectors. Due to continued growth and success of the Company we are looking to recruit a Refrigeration Engineer to cover Hampshire, Wiltshire and Dorset. Service, maintenance and repair of all commercial refrigeration equipment: ice machines, display fridges, coldrooms, blast chillers, bottle coolers Fault finding on refrigeration and some air conditioning equipment Field based meeting clients – Customer facing position Essential Qualifications / Experience: FGAS or Equivalent Minimum 12 months recent experience working on Refrigeration or air conditioning Equipment Driver’s Licence DBS to be carried out Package Overview Competitive basic salary up to £42,000pa. (This is negotiable depending on experience) 40 hour week Monday – Friday (No on call) Paid door to door 25 days annual holiday, plus 8 bank holidays Smart Phone / Tablet / Uniform Van + Fuel Card Company pension Weekly overtime paid at time and a half Monday – Saturday Double time Sundays & Bank Holidays #ENG1
